Abstract
BACKGROUND: Glomerulomegaly, the abnormal enlargement of glomeruli, has been related to an increased risk of glomerulosclerosis, but the degree of enlargement that constitutes glomerulomegaly has not been defined.Entities:

Fig. 1Histogram of Vglom (m3 × 106) for African American and white subjects with kernel density plots of non-hypertensive (blue line) and hypertensive subjects (red line). The volume estimates are skewed towards larger glomerular size.
Fig. 2Histogram of IVglom (m3 × 106) for African American and white subjects with kernel density plots of non-hypertensive (blue line) and hypertensive subjects (red line). The volume estimates are more closely clustered around the median than in Figure 1 but are still skewed towards larger glomerular size.
Fig. 3Vglom (m3 × 106) plotted against MAP. There is no significant relationship between the two variables.
Fig. 4IVglom (m3 × 106) plotted against MAP. There is a significant direct relationship between the two variables (adjusted r2 = 0.130, P = 0.01). A MAP = 107 mmHg is hypertensive, and there is no level of IVglom that separates hypertensive from non-hypertensive subjects.
